在虚拟化技术日益普及的今天,搭建虚拟机并实现VPN已经成为很多网络工程师和开发者的重要技能之一,虚拟机的配置和VPN的搭建需要扎实的技术基础,以及耐心的调试过程,以下将详细介绍如何搭建虚拟机,并实现VPN功能。

虚拟机的配置与基础设置

  1. 选择合适的虚拟化平台
    选择适合自己的虚拟化平台,如VCenter、VirtualBox、SetStack等,这些平台提供了全面的虚拟机管理功能,包括硬件配置、软件安装、虚拟机管理等。

  2. 硬件配置
    在虚拟机上安装必要的硬件设备,包括电源、主板、电源管理器等,确保硬件配置符合虚拟机的要求,并确保网络设备能够连接到虚拟机。

  3. 软件安装
    安装必要的软件,包括操作系统(如Windows、macOS)、网络管理工具(如Linux、VMware)、文件系统管理工具(如NAT工具)等。

NAT接口的配置

  1. 配置NAT接口
    在虚拟机上,NAT接口的作用是将内部网络的IP地址映射到外部网络,实现数据流量的分层传输,配置NAT接口需要确保内部网络的流量能够正确映射到外部网络。

  2. IP地址的配置
    在NAT接口的配置中,需要明确内部网络的IP地址范围和外部网络的IP地址范围,确保内部和外部网络的IP地址不冲突,并且内部网络的流量能够正确映射到外部网络。

  3. 防火墙的设置
    防火墙是保证数据安全的重要工具,在配置NAT接口时,还需要配置防火墙,确保内部网络的流量能够安全地通过NAT接口到达外部网络。

VPN的搭建与配置

  1. 选择VPN服务器
    网络工程师需要选择一个合适的VPN服务器,该服务器需要具备足够的计算资源、稳定的网络连接和可靠的数据传输能力,选择VPN服务器时,可以参考用户需求和预算,选择最适合的VPN服务提供商。

  2. 配置VPN服务器
    在虚拟机上,配置VPN服务器需要考虑以下几点:

    • IP地址的选择:选择一个适合平方的IP地址,确保IP地址的范围和配置符合用户的需求。
    • 端口的设置:配置VPN服务器的端口,确保内部网络的流量能够安全地通过NAT接口到达外部网络,并且能够正确地连接到VPN服务器。
  3. 防火墙的设置
    在配置VPN服务器时,还需要配置防火墙,确保外部网络的流量能够安全地连接到VPN服务器,防火墙的作用是过滤掉外部网络的流量,防止未经授权的访问。

  4. 数据传输的控制
    网络工程师需要确保数据传输的控制,避免数据丢失或损坏,在配置VPN服务器时,可以使用虚拟化工具来控制数据传输的路径和速度。

案例分析

在实际操作中,网络工程师需要根据具体的需求和环境来调整配置,如果内部网络的流量比较小,就可以使用简单的配置;如果内部网络的流量较大,就需要使用更复杂的配置,用户需要根据自己的情况调整防火墙的设置,以确保数据的安全性和合规性。

搭建虚拟机并实现VPN功能需要掌握虚拟化平台的配置技巧,以及丰富的网络管理工具,通过不断的调试和实验,可以更好地理解虚拟机的运行过程和VPN功能的实现,希望这份指南能帮助到许多网络工程师和开发者,让他们在搭建虚拟机和实现VPN时能够事半功倍。

如何搭建虚拟机并实现VPN?全面解析步骤与细节  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速